github pages 自定义域名失效

github pages 自定义域名失效

vuepress 部署 blog 的时候自定义域名经常失效的原因

把 dist 目录下的文件全部提交到 gh-pages(或者 master) 分支上去作为 pages 的展示的内容,但是 CNAME 文件没有提交上去,也就是说,vuepress 项目作为 blog 的 CNAME 文件(自定义域名)需要放在 .vuepress/public 中,而不是实际当前的根目录下(如果你的目录跟我类似的话)

这里推测 github pages 的 setting 中的 custom domain 与项目的展示 pages 分支的根目录下的 CNAME 文件是起同样的作用的。

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 很早之前我就记得某篇讲hexo的文章里提到每个GitHub只能拥有一个GitHub Pages页面,所以后来一直不...
    一條小喇叭阅读 1,852评论 0 0
  • 之前折腾的各种vps,包括vultr、HostUS、DigitalOcean等等,由于一些不可抗力,服务器开始都还...
    Yuan2021阅读 4,470评论 0 0
  • 这篇博客将整理在配置博客以及项目 Pages 的自定义域名过程,遇到的问题以及解决方法。Github 的文档对于如...
    qiwihui阅读 5,180评论 0 0
  • 子曰:“学如不及,犹恐失之。”子曰:“巍巍乎!舜、禹之有天下也而不与焉。”子曰:“大哉尧之为君也!巍巍乎,唯天为大...
    小鑫芝士阅读 1,683评论 0 0
  • 歌唱流星是困难的 我来不及张喉 它已闪失 歌唱彩虹和歌唱流星一样 稍纵即逝 那就歌唱烛光吧 谁知它竟附和我的心事 ...
    诗人宁文阅读 3,150评论 0 1